MOLLY WATT'S HILL | Mollywatt's Hill Mollywatt's Hill Mollywatt's Hill Maliewat |
Mr John Gordon. Upper Towie Mr Charles Morrison Culfork Mr Alexander Cameron (Mains of Tillypronie) Macfarlane 1725 |
070 | A conspicuous eminence, known by this name. over which, the parish boundary crosses. and derives its name from a person named Mary. Watt. |
GREEN HILL | Green Hill Green Hill Green Hill Red Skairs |
Mr John Gordon Mr Charles Morrison Mr Alexander Cameron Estate Plan 1864 |
070 | A conspicuous eminence, so called over which the parish boundary crosses and on the summit there is a small shepherds cairn, it is sometimes call the Scar Hill or the Red Skairs, but is best known by the Green Hill |
BROOM HILL | Broom Hill Broom Hill Broom Hill Broom of the Davoch |
Mr John Gordon Mr Charles Morrison Mr Alexander Cameron Estate Plan 1864 |
070 | A very conspicuous eminence known by this, from formerly being covered with broom &c. |

[Page] 48Parish of Logie Coldstone
[Note beside 'Molly Watt's Hill'] Maliewat - Macfarlane 1725. Shd [Should] enter it one word. The derivation given is quite absurd - in my opinion. [Initialled] JMcD.
